Our new mission:
"Pregnancy & Family Support Services is an inner-city agency dedicated to offering services that support pregnant women, foster family life, empower individuals and grow community".

Founded in 1973 as a crisis line for pregnant women, Pregnancy and Family Support Services Inc.( Formerly known as Pregnancy Distress Family Support Services Inc.) is committed to offering immediate and long term, quality support and counselling to women, men, and families seeking help.
Over the years, the agency has established a significant presence in the inner city. We serve families with multiple needs from two locations. We also operate a thrift shop which offers an important service to the community. All revenue generated by the thrift shop goes directly into agency programs and services. Volunteer opportunities are also available for both women and men.
Incorporated as a non-profit organization, the agency is support through private donations, The United Way, Manitoba Child Daycares, The Dept. of Child and Family Support, and through other organized community groups, corporations, and foundations. The Mennonite Central Committee has provided volunteer staff since 1977.
